Analysis

Uzbekistan recorded 0 m3 for wood chips and particles — export quantity in 2024. That is the lowest value across all 32 years on record.

Over the whole period, wood chips and particles — export quantity in Uzbekistan peaked at 311 m3 in 1993 and was at its lowest, 0 m3, in 2012.

That places Uzbekistan 129th out of 161 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the bottom quarter.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

The database contains data on the production and trade in roundwood and in prim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world.The main types of primary forest products included in this database are ro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further and defined in the Joint Forest Sector Questionnaire (JFSQ) (https://www.fao.org/statistics/data-collection/forestry/en). The database contains details of the following topics: - roundwood removals (production) by coniferous and non-coniferous wood and assortments, - production and trade in industrial ro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, wood charcoal, pulp, paper and paperboard, and other products.
